Help, just kidding but I could use some tips. Recently, it seems Like the Small mouth Bas bite on Lake Amistad has exploded. I have fish the lake for the past 24 years but have only caught a few through out the years but this year they are everywhere i have caught them from the Devil’s river to around buoy 23. I have been catching them in bunches but nothing of size. Everything has been just under 14”. So i say with a heavy heart that so far this year i have yet to catch a keeper small mouth. I have caught them on crank baits, jerk baits, top water plugs and a few on senkos. I dont know if i need to changed technique or strategy to catch some bronze hawgs. Does anyone have any tips?

I have caught tons of them over the years down there and many more recently compared to 40 years ago when they were more localized to certain areas. Now it seems you might catch one anywhere. No advice on how to catch a bigger one. I seldom catch one over about 2.5 lbs, and like you said, the majority are smaller. If you are in an area where you are catching little ones, stay there and work it over with craw-type baits--football jigs, brown cranks. I have seen no rhyme or reason to the slightly larger ones I catch--you just have to wade through lots of small ones.
You can run up the arms and sometimes get into better ones, but that hasn't been a focus of mine.

I have been targeting rocks, all kinds of rocks big rocks little rocks. Rocks with steep drop off and rocks with easy slopes. I have noticed that sandy bottoms and those bronze hawgs dont go good together and the bigger the rocks the better the bite. I have had a better bite where ever i find larger boulders in around 5-10 feet of water. Top water bite has been better where ever i have smaller rocky areas with an easy slope and a deep drop off. I am thinking of starting to target the drop offs with a football head jig head and a Beatle/craw style lure. They seem to be pretty aggressive right not but i would like to land a few three pounders if possible.

I got some football jigs and gonna order some brown cranks and see what happens. I really bite has been the best around box canyon. The bite was best close to the main channel and if i got more than like 100 yards into a cove the bite would pretty much die. I also just rigged up a few spinning reels with 10lb line and see if that leads to some bigger fish.
